Employees will have 3 shift options, 7am-1pm, 12pm-6pm or 8am-12pm & 1pm-5pm. We will be located at Bemidji High School for this summer.
Site Leaders :
The hourly pay range is $14.74
  • 20.
53.
Requirements:
(1) experience training, leading. and providing guidance to multiple staff members, (2) strong organizational & problem solving skills, (3) flexible and positive attitude, (4) ability to assist other staff with understanding the needs and behaviors of young children, and (5) interpersonal skills with children and adults.
Activity Leaders :
The hourly pay range is $14.29-19.79.
Requirements:
(1) education courses related to school age development &/or experience working with elementary age school children (2) strong interpersonal skills, (3) ability to plan and lead developmentally appropriate activities for young children, and (4) positively guide and provide direction to other staff. Potential required work date includes June 10, 2026, for program setup and training. The program will be closed June 19th. Preference given to those available to work Monday
  • Friday for the duration of the program.
Preference will also be given to those with previous experience in Kids & Company or Summer Kids & Company.
